Output 64094ec20ee25091bbf4ae5021a076593b966bcbf867b89b76ba7803471fd608:0

value
962990
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c1cc7de03d1bfb1bf38ef35779c1917b870cdbb OP_EQUALVERIFY OP_CHECKSIG
address
152FDAKz3yqYMk399svXM2VwzqBFfbJ1Zx
transaction
64094ec20ee25091bbf4ae5021a076593b966bcbf867b89b76ba7803471fd608
spent
true